What evidence or argument do you have, apart from personal opinion, to support that argument? The introduction of a New Zealand team in the NRL has ultimately led to them being World Cup winners which is a pretty big argument for players playing in the best competition in the world.

I get your point about improving the game over here is the only way in which we will catch up and how retaining the best British players over here is critical to doing that. However that doesn't mean the original point about the importance of British players testing themselves at the highest club level is invalid. It will always be valid for as long as the NRL is significantly ahead of Super League in terms of quality and intensity.

If we want to catch up with the aussies, then having our lads go over there should mean they can eventually bring what they've learned back (whether it be returning to a club or joining the boys at international camp), which will improve our game. It'll take more than two players to make a big difference, but the more they realise there are actually some poms who can play a bit, then the more interest our lads will get from the aussie clubs.

IMO there's plenty of british lads who could, as individuals, slot in to NRL teams and do decent jobs. The Aussie clubs may start see a hard working pom with a point to prove as a decent alternative to some crazy polynesian (given the flood of negetive headlines the NRL clubs seem to be getting).
